#333871 is rgb(51, 56, 113) in RGB, hsl(235, 38%, 32%) in HSL, and about cmyk(55%, 50%, 0%, 56%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Yale Blue (#00356B), visibly different at ΔE 10.18. White text is the more readable choice on this background.

What #333871 Is Called

Most hex codes have no name: there are 16.7 million of them and a few thousand registered names. These are the named colors nearest to #333871, ordered by CIE76 distance in CIELAB. Anything under about ΔE 2 is a difference most people cannot see.

Text Contrast & Accessibility

W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#333871 background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

How #333871 Looks with Color Vision Deficiency

Simulated with the Viénot, Brettel & Mollon LMS projection model. Anomalous types are rendered as partial versions of the matching dichromacy, which is an approximation rather than a per-person clinical model.

#333871 Frequently Asked Questions

What color is #333871?

#333871 is a dark blue — rgb(51, 56, 113) in RGB and hsl(235, 38%, 32%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Yale Blue (#00356B), which is visibly different at a CIE76 distance of 10.18.

What is the RGB value of #333871?

#333871 is rgb(51, 56, 113) — red 51, green 56, and blue 113 on the 0-255 scale.

What is the CMYK value of #333871?

#333871 converts to approximately cmyk(55%, 50%, 0%, 56%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.

Should text on #333871 be black or white?

White text is the more readable choice. #333871 scores 10.8:1 against white and 1.94: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.

Can I write #333871 as a CSS color keyword?

No. #333871 is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is darkslateblue (#483D8B) at a CIE76 distance of 13.76, which is visibly different.
